Transaction 77fe34df1d63f5c94527d534576f26c17c901264a95e93b23f19d9b4bb78b838
1 Input
1 Output
-
77fe34df1d63f5c94527d534576f26c17c901264a95e93b23f19d9b4bb78b838:0
- value
- 628194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dfd329453a383aaf775e250cd21d12bc8be88bb OP_EQUAL
- address
- 32xz2WjmrXLCfatSvyBJvGFdwBks2W4u6H